Boston Celtics: Laser-Focused on Playoffs
According to insights from Bleacher Report’s Greg Swartz, succinctly capturing the essence of the Boston Celtics can be summed up in the phrase: “Can the playoffs start already?” The sentiment reflects the team’s singular focus on postseason success this year.
“They hold a six-game lead over the Cleveland Cavaliers for first place in the East and are now 8.5 games up on the Milwaukee Bucks, the team that was supposed to push the Celtics for the No. 1 seed,” writes Swartz.
As the NBA’s regular season winds down, the Celtics have their eyes firmly set on securing another shot at the title in the upcoming 2024 NBA Finals. However, achieving this goal is no easy task. Swartz highlights the challenge the team faces in maintaining motivation during the final eight weeks of the season, with their minds already fixed on playoff contention.
Despite this, the Celtics currently boast a commanding six-game lead over the Cleveland Cavaliers in the Eastern Conference, with an impressive 8.5-game advantage over the Milwaukee Bucks, once viewed as strong contenders for the top seed.
Swartz underscores the veteran-heavy makeup of the team, suggesting that additional regular-season games may not be necessary for cohesion. Instead, the focus lies on ensuring the team enters the playoffs in peak physical condition.
“This is a veteran-heavy group that doesn’t need many more regular-season reps together and should be more concerned with just entering the playoffs healthy,” he adds.
“This is a championship-or-bust season for Boston, the NBA’s best team thus far. Staying awake through the remainder of the regular season will the greatest challenge until mid-April.”
For the Celtics, this season represents a “championship-or-bust” mentality, given their status as the NBA’s top-performing team thus far. However, Swartz notes that maintaining momentum through the remaining regular-season fixtures will be the ultimate challenge until the postseason commences in mid-April.
